THE LIVING YOGA MENTORSHIP

What to Expect

THE LIVING YOGA MENTORSHIP is an ongoing space for graduates to deepen their practice, refine their teaching, and continue walking the path of yoga in community. Through monthly mentoring, embodied practice, personalised sadhana, and open discussion, you'll receive guidance, accountability and inspiration as your practice continues to evolve.

❋ Monthly Live Mentoring

Join a live monthly mentoring session where we'll come together for practice, learning and discussion. Each gathering includes an embodied practice, exploration of a monthly theme, and dedicated time for questions, mentoring and shared inquiry.

❋ Personal Monthly Sadhana

Each month you will be offered a daily sadhana, one that works for your specific circumstances and capacity. This is a great way to keep some structure in your practice post training- with a little less intensity! Everyone will follow the same theme for the month, to keep the group energy consistent.

❋ Online Studio Access

Full free access to our complete library of classes, challenges and programs. We will use these classes as the basis for the monthly sadhana.

❋ Continuing Education

Continue to build on the foundations of your Yoga Teacher Training through ongoing study, reflection and practical application. Together we'll explore philosophy, teaching methodology, subtle body practices and the evolving art of living yoga. As part of this you will receive 15 hours ongoing professional development certification through Yoga Alliance.

❋ Deeper Practices & Initiations

As the mentorship unfolds, there may be opportunities to explore more advanced yogic practices, including mantra, meditation, pranayama, kriya and Ucchara. These teachings will be offered organically as they become relevant to the group and your individual development.

❋ A Space to Ask Questions

Whether you're navigating your own practice, teaching classes, or integrating the teachings into everyday life, you'll have a supportive space to bring your questions. No question is too big or too small, this is an opportunity to receive guidance within a trusted community.
